Key Blockchain Security Standards for Vietnam

To withstand the evolving threats, crypto exchanges must adhere to various security standards. Here’s a closer look:

Vietnam crypto exchange security

1. Multi-Signature Wallets

Multi-signature wallets require multiple keys to authorize a transaction. This acts as a safeguard against unauthorized access, similar to how a bank requires multiple authorizations for large transactions.

2. Regular Security Audits

Conducting regular audits—like in traditional finance—helps identify vulnerabilities in the system. Smart contracts, for instance, should be consistently monitored. In 2025, a reported 35% of all DeFi platforms will undergo third-party audits.

3. User Education and Awareness

Educating users about common scams and phishing attempts can significantly reduce risk. Offering resources on cryptocurrency best practices will empower your users to protect their investments.

4. Compliance with Local Regulations

Staying compliant with Vietnam’s evolving regulations on cryptocurrency is essential. This includes understanding the latest compliance guidelines related to KYC (Know Your Customer) and AML (Anti-Money Laundering).

5. Advanced Encryption Technologies

Utilizing top-notch encryption reduces the risk of data breaches. Just as you wouldn’t store cash in an unlocked drawer, not using encryption is inviting trouble. In fact, the latest advancements in encryption can reduce vulnerabilities by 50%.

Best Practices for Users

  • Enable two-factor authentication (2FA) on all accounts.
  • Utilize hardware wallets for large holdings.
  • Regularly review security practices and stay updated with industry news.
